目的本研究观察32℃亚低温对实验性脑出血大鼠24h内死亡率和脑组织钙含量的影响。方法134只大鼠分成两部分:(1)68只大鼠用于死亡率观察;(2)66只大鼠用于脑组织钙含量测定。每一部分分成假手术对照组、常温脑出血组及亚低温脑出血组。结果常温组24h内死亡率为36.67%,亚低温组为4.55%;脑组织钙含量常温组较对照组和亚低温组为高。结论亚低温治疗能显著减少实验性脑出血大鼠24h内死亡率,减少脑出血后脑组织钙含量。  相似文献

目的 建立大鼠实验性脑出血(1CH)模型,研究头部局部亚低温对大鼠脑组织炎性细胞因子和核转录因子-κB(NF-κB)表达的影响,从而探讨头部局部亚低温的脑保护作用.方法 选用Wistar大鼠,采用大鼠脑内缓慢注入非肝素化自体血的方法,建立实验性ICH动物模型.随机分为亚低温组、常温组、假手术组.亚低温组在建立模型后立即应用头部局部亚低温治疗48h.48h后用HE染色法观察实验组与对照组脑组织的病理变化,用免疫组化法研究肿瘤坏死因子-α (TNF-α)、NF-κB在各组表达的差异.结果 成功地建立了大鼠实验性ICH模型.ICH后48h,亚低温组血肿周围炎细胞较常温组显著减少,脑组织水肿明显轻于常温组,胶质细胞反应较轻,周围小血管出血现象轻于常温组.常温组血肿周围及注血侧皮质、胼胝体、脉络丛内TNF-α、NF-κB表达较假手术组明显增多(P<0.01),亚低温组的表达较常温组有显著减少(P<0.05).结论 (1)大鼠脑内缓慢注入非肝素化自体血,可建立可靠、重复性好的实验性ICH动物模型.(2)大鼠ICH急性期脑组织内NF-κB和前炎性细胞因子TNF-α显著增加.(3)头部局部亚低温治疗可以抑制大鼠ICH后脑组织TNF-α和NF-κB的表达.(4)头部局部亚低温治疗在抑制实验性ICH炎症反应方面的脑保护作用与它抑制NF-κB的表达有关.  相似文献

亚低温治疗对实验性大鼠脑出血的保护作用研究   总被引:27,自引:0,他引:27  
目的 本文观察了32 ℃亚低温对脑出血大鼠脑 Na+ 、 K+ 、水含量及超微结构的影响。方法 66 只大鼠随机分成三组: (1) 假手术对照组; (2) 常温脑出血组; (3) 亚低温脑出血组。结果常温出血组水、 Na+ 含量随时间而增加, 而 K+ 含量减少; 亚低温组水、 Na+ 含量比常温组低, 而 K+含量增加。超微结构显示亚低温组脑超微结构损害较常温组轻。结论 亚低温治疗对脑出血后脑水肿, 脑细胞结构有保护作用。  相似文献

局部亚低温对脑出血后水肿影响的实验研究   总被引:6,自引:1,他引:6  
目的探讨局部亚低温对大鼠脑出血后水肿形成的影响及其可能机制。方法雄性Wistar大鼠230只随机分为:对照组;脑出血组;脑出血加局部亚低温组;凝血酶加局部亚低温组。应用Evans-Blue测定血脑屏障(BBB)通透性,应用干湿重法测定脑水含量。结果与对照组相比,大鼠注血后6h开始出现脑组织水含量和BBB通透性的增加,在72h达到高峰,然后逐渐消退。不同时程局部亚低温均可以显著降低脑出血后72h时脑组织水含量及BBB通透性(P<0.01),其中给以4h局部亚低温时,降低最明显。注射凝血酶6h后,脑组织水含量及BBB通透性显著增高(P<0.01),于24~48h达高峰,然后逐渐下降。凝血酶 局部亚低温组在各个时间点与凝血酶组相比,脑组织水含量及BBB通透性明显降低(P<0.01)。结论局部亚低温可能是通过抑制凝血酶的毒性作用来减轻脑出血后水肿的形成及血脑屏障的破坏。  相似文献

目的 观察局部亚低温对脑出血大鼠血肿周围脑组织的形态学变化和对白介素(IL)-1β表达的影响.方法 72只Wistar大鼠随机分为假手术组和脑出血后6 h、24 h、48 h、72 h、7 d组,每组再分为常温亚组和亚低温亚组,每个亚组6只大鼠.采用自体不凝血注人大鼠尾状核制备脑出血模型.各亚低温亚组注血后实施亚低温治疗4 h,维持脑温在(33±0.5)℃.观察血肿周围组织的形态学改变和IL-1β表达的变化.结果 亚低温亚组各时间点脑组织水肿明显轻于常温亚组;神经元变性坏死、炎症反应及胶质细胞增生程度明显轻于常温亚组.脑出血后6 h血肿周围脑组织IL-1β开始表达,48 h达高峰,7 d时仍明显高于对照亚组(均P<0.01).脑出血24 h~7 d亚低温亚组IL-1β表达水平较相应时点常温亚组显著降低(均P<0.01).结论 亚低温治疗能明显抑制血肿周围IL-1β的过度表达,减轻血肿周围脑组织的炎症反应.  相似文献

目的研究亚低温对延迟时间窗再灌注的局灶脑缺血大鼠缺血性脑水肿的治疗作用。方法 SD雄性大鼠96只,线栓法制作大脑中动脉闭塞模型后随机分为缺血3 h组、缺血6 h组、缺血9 h组(每组各30只),分别在造模3 h、6 h和9 h后拔出线栓,使大脑中动脉再灌注。各缺血组按照再灌注后是否给予亚低温治疗及亚低温持续时间分为常温、亚低温3 h和亚低温5 h三个亚组,每个亚组有10只大鼠。另设假手术组6只。缺血组大鼠在再灌注24 h后处死取脑,假手术组在术后24 h处死取脑,干-湿重法测定各组缺血侧脑组织含水量并进行比较。结果与假手术组比较,缺血组缺血侧脑组织含水量明显增高。缺血3 h组中3 h亚低温和5 h亚低温亚组的缺血侧脑组织含水量与缺血3 h常温组比较,差异有统计学意义(79.39%±2.44%vs82.16%±1.50%,P0.05;79.20%±1.55%vs 82.16%±1.50%,P0.05)。其余各缺血组中经过亚低温治疗的大鼠与常温亚组的脑组织含水量无统计学差异。结论亚低温可减轻缺血早期(3 h)再灌注的脑组织水肿,保护缺血脑组织,而对晚期(6 h和9 h)再灌注的缺血性脑水肿无论亚低温时间长短均无明显保护作用。  相似文献

亚低温对大鼠脑缺血再灌注后炎性反应的影响   总被引:4,自引:0,他引:4  
目的:观察亚低温的不同时程对大鼠脑缺血再灌注后炎性反应的影响。方法:24只SD大鼠随机分为4组:常温组,亚低温1/2h组,亚低温1h组和亚低温3h组。每组各6只大鼠。参照Zea Longa的方法建立脑缺血再灌注动物模型,于再灌注24h断头取脑,行HE染色,观察脑组织中自细胞浸润及神经细胞的变化情况。结果:常温组在缺血梗死灶周围区可见白细胞浸润明显及深染受损的神经元;随亚低温时间的延长,白细胞浸润逐渐减少,神经元亦表现为淡染的轻度损伤。结论:亚低温可抑制脑缺血再灌注后的白细胞浸润,具有神经保护作用。  相似文献

目的观察局部亚低温对大鼠自体血注入法脑出血模型血红素氧合酶(HO-1)表达的影响,探讨局部亚低温减轻脑出血后脑水肿的可能机制。方法雄性Wistar大鼠120只,随机分为脑出血(control)组和脑出血加局部亚低温(LMH)组。每组分为对照和脑出血后6h、24h、72h,5d、7d共6个亚组,亚低温组于注血后给予4h的局部亚低温治疗,应用Evans-blue测定血脑屏障(BBB)通透性,应用干湿重法测定脑水含量以及应用免疫组化对血肿周围脑组织HO-1的表达进行测定。结果对照组大鼠脑组织含水量、BBB通透性以及HO-1表达的增加始于脑出血后6h均至72h达高峰。HO-1表达的变化与脑血肿周围组织水含量的变化成呈正相关(r=0.79)。LMH组的脑组织水含量、BBB通透性和HO-1各时间点与对照组相比明显下降。结论脑出血后红细胞的破坏可以导致HO-1表达上升。局部亚低温可抑制脑出血后HO-1表达,减轻血脑屏障完整性的破坏,减轻脑出血后脑水肿形成。  相似文献

目的 研究延迟性亚低温对大鼠脑出血后神经细胞凋亡及神经功能缺损的动态影响.方法 将大鼠随机分为正常组(N),假手术组(S),脑出血组(M),延迟12h亚低温组(HT12)和延迟24h亚低温组(HT24).应用立体定向技术将Ⅳ型胶原酶注人大鼠尾壳核制作脑出血模型,模型制备后于12h及24h点将大鼠放入冷室降温,维持肛温在(33±1)℃,均持续12h,各组在模型制作后12h、24h、36h、3d、7d记录大鼠神经功能缺损评分及死亡率.大鼠脑组织做HE染色及TUNEL染色,流式细胞技术观察神经细胞凋亡数目的变化.结果 亚低温(HT12,HT24)可减少脑出血后大鼠各时间点的TUNEL染色的阳性细胞数(P<0.05);与模型组相比,3d时亚低温组( HT12,HT24)神经细胞凋亡率及大鼠7d的死亡率明显降低(P<0.05),差别有统计学意义;延迟24h的亚低温可降低大鼠7d的NDS评分(P<0.05),而12h的延迟治疗无此作用(P>0.05).结论 延迟的亚低温治疗可减少大鼠脑出血后神经细胞的凋亡,降低死亡率,发挥脑保护作用.  相似文献

目的观察亚低温(32~35℃)对局灶性脑缺血后大鼠脑组织C3表达的影响。方法 100只大鼠随机分成假手术组、常温组和亚低温组,各组根据观察时间点分为术后6h、1d、2d、3d、7d五个亚组。建立大鼠左侧大脑中动脉闭塞(MCAO)模型,应用冰袋降温的方法使亚低温组大鼠肛温10min内降至(33℃±1℃),维持低温6h后复温。假手术组和常温组大鼠保持肛温(37℃±0.5℃)。在各时间点采用神经缺陷评分对各大鼠进行神经功能评分后断头取脑,行苏木素伊红染色观察脑缺血病理学改变,免疫组织化学染色观察不同时间点C3表达情况。结果假手术组大鼠清醒后无神经功能障碍,常温组及亚低温组大鼠清醒后均出现左侧Horner征及不同程度右侧前肢为重的偏瘫,两组大鼠神经功能缺损3d时最明显,7d时均有所减轻。除6h外各时间点亚低温组大鼠神经功能缺损评分均较常温组低(P〈0.05),各时间点亚低温组大鼠脑组织病理学损伤较常温组轻。在各时间点假手术组大鼠脑组织中C3可见少许表达,各组间比较差异无统计学意义(P〉0.05)。常温组和亚低温组大鼠缺血侧脑组织于缺血后6h补体C3阳性细胞数均开始增加,至3d均达到高峰,到7d时C3阳性细胞数明显减少,与常温组相比,亚低温组各时间点缺血侧脑组织C3表达明显减少(P〈0.05)。结论脑缺血时,缺血侧脑组织C3有表达,亚低温可使C3表达减少。亚低温可能通过降低C3的表达减轻补体级联反应起脑保护作用。  相似文献

Background Dementia occurs in the majority of patients with Parkinson’s disease (PD). Late onset of PD has been reported to be associated with a higher risk for dementia. However, age at onset (AAO) and age at baseline assessment are often correlated. The aim of this study was to explore whether AAO of PD symptoms is a risk factor for dementia independent of the general effect of age. Methods Two community-based studies of PD in New York (n = 281) and Rogaland county, Norway (n = 227) and two population-based groups of healthy elderly from New York (n = 180) and Odense, Denmark (n = 2414) were followed prospectively for 3–4 years and assessed for dementia according to DSM-IIIR. All PD and control cases underwent neurological examination and were followed with neurological and neuropsychological assessments. We used Cox proportional hazards regression based on three different time scales to explore the effect of AAO of PD on risk of dementia, adjusting for age at baseline and other demographic and clinical variables. Findings In both PD groups and in the pooled analyses, there was a significant effect of age at baseline assessment on the time to develop dementia, but there was no effect of AAO independent of age itself. Consistent with these results, there was no increased relative effect of age on the time to develop dementia in PD cases compared with controls. Interpretation This study shows that it is the general effect of age, rather than AAO that is associated with incident dementia in subjects with PD. 目的分析帕金森病(PD)患者运动症状进展特点。方法采用PD统一评分量表(UPDRS)Ⅲ对912例PD患者进行评估。结果与病程1年的患者比较,除病程1~2年的患者外,其他病程患者的UPDRSⅢ评分、强直分、姿势或步态异常分、轴性症状总分、言语分、步态分显著升高(均P0.05),病程5~6年及14年患者的震颤分,病程5~6年、7~8年、9~13年、14年患者的运动迟缓分、姿势分显著升高(P0.05~0.01)。轴性症状进展速度高于UPDRSⅢ评分。结论 PD患者病程早期UPDRSⅢ评分进展快,震颤症状进展独立于其他症状,轴性症状评分较UPDRSⅢ更敏感地反映疾病加重趋势。  相似文献

Summary The frequency of accumulation of 6-nm filaments in the adaxonal cytoplasm of Schwann cells in the 6th lumbar dorsal and ventral roots was evaluated in 4-, 8-, 26- and 45-week-old Sprague-Dawley rats. The frequency was higher in 4- and 8-week-old (growing) rats than in 26- and 45-week old (mature) rats, and also higher in ventral than in dorsal roots in 4-, 8- and 26-week old rats. There were no clusters on certain groups of myelinated fibers according to the size of transverse axonal area, in both the ventral and dorsal roots. Therefore, this accumulation may reflect certain functions of the adaxonal cytoplasm of Schwann cell during natural growth and maturation of the axon and myelin sheath.  相似文献

Nearly 400 years ago, Thomas Willis described the arterial ring at the base of the brain (the circle of Willis, CW) and recognized it as a compensatory system in the case of arterial occlusion. This theory is still accepted. We present several arguments that via negativa should discard the compensatory theory. (1) Current theory is anthropocentric; it ignores other species and their analog structures. (2) Arterial pathologies are diseases of old age, appearing after gene propagation. (3) According to the current theory, evolution has foresight. (4) Its commonness among animals indicates that it is probably a convergent evolutionary structure. (5) It was observed that communicating arteries are too small for effective blood flow, and (6) missing or hypoplastic in the majority of the population. We infer that CW, under physiologic conditions, serves as a passive pressure dissipating system; without considerable blood flow, pressure is transferred from the high to low pressure end, the latter being another arterial component of CW. Pressure gradient exists because pulse wave and blood flow arrive into the skull through different cerebral arteries asynchronously, due to arterial tree asymmetry. Therefore, CW and its communicating arteries protect cerebral artery and blood–brain barrier from hemodynamic stress.  相似文献

目的 探讨他汀类药物对颅内动脉瘤破裂的影响。方法 2010年3月至2014年3月收治颅内囊状动脉瘤67例,其中破裂者32例,未破裂者35例。采用多变量Logistic回归评估他汀类药物的使用和颅内动脉瘤破裂的关系。结果 破裂组术前使用他汀类药物4例(12.5%,4/32),未破裂组16例(45.7%,16/35)。破裂组服用他汀类药物的百分比显著低于未破裂组(P<0.01)。纠正潜在的混杂干扰后(or值: 0.30,95%可信空间:0.12~="" 0.64)显示,颅内动脉瘤破裂与他汀类药物的使用呈显著负相关,也与高血清总胆固醇浓度有关。结论 本结果提示他汀类药物对颅内动脉瘤破裂有一定的预防效果。  相似文献

Impact of our understanding of the genetic aetiology of epilepsy   总被引:2,自引:0,他引:2  
A genetic contribution to aetiology is estimated to be present in up to 40% of patients with epilepsy. It is useful to categorise genetic epilepsies according to the mechanisms of inheritance into Mendelian disorders, non-mendelian or ‘complex’ disorders, and chromosomal disorders. Over 200 Mendelian diseases include epilepsy as part of the phenotype, and the genes for a number of these have been identified recently. These include autosomal recessive progressive myoclonic epilepsies such as Unverricht-Lundborg disease, Lafora disease and the neuronal ceroid lipofuscinoses, and three autosomal dominant idiopathic epilepsies. The last named have been shown to arise from mutations in ion channel genes. Autosomal dominant nocturnal frontal lobe epilepsy is caused by mutations in CHRNA4, benign familial neonatal convulsions by mutations in KCNQ2 and KCNQ3, and generalised epilepsy with febrile seizures plus by mutations in SCN1B. ‘Complex’, familial epilepsies are more difficult to analyse, but evidence has been obtained for loci predisposing to juvenile myoclonic epilepsy on chromosome 6p and 15q. Lastly, the genes underlying several spike-wave epilepsies in mice have been cloned, and three of these encode sub-units of voltage-gated calcium channels. 目的掌握肌萎缩侧索硬化(ALS)的诊断标准,以便早期准确诊断,避免误诊。方法分析3例ALS患者早期被误诊的临床资料。结果 3例患者均以下肢无力发病,逐渐波及上肢或对侧肢体,脊柱MR I示颈部或腰部椎间盘突出压迫硬膜囊,手术治疗后,症状无缓解,病情仍进行性加重,经肌电图检查证实为ALS。结论临床医师应熟知ALS的诊断标准,对患者详细询问病史、认真查体和电生理检查是减少ALS误诊的关键。  相似文献

BULL. 3(5) 411–413, 1978.—The effects of unilateral extirpation of the right optic cup of the three-day incubated chick embryo upon the rate of synthesis and the stability of DNA in the non-innervated optic lobe, have been studied. This surgical procedure prevents innervation of the optic lobe contralateral to the removed eye, while the other optic lobe is normally innervated by retinal ganglion cells of the remaining eye. At the 20th day of incubation, the DNA content of the non-innervated lobe was below that of the paired lobe receiving normal innervation. This deficiency of cell number was caused by two events; death of an excess number of neurons formed early in embryogenesis and a reduced rate of glial proliferation in the later stages of incubation.  相似文献

This article discusses the control methods of the central pattern generator (CPG). First a control model of the CPG is presented using 2 oscillators, and we suggest that phasic modulation to the CPG by means of phasic information is effective for controlling the phase difference between oscillators. Next, two models for controlling the CPG of a lamprey are proposed. One model describes a control system from the brain stem, in which the reticulospinal neurons control the CPG by receiving feedback signals and sending control signals to the neck region of the CPG. The other is a model for learning an localized control system to generate a desired motor pattern. By means of these models, a role of the efference copy is suggested.  相似文献

利培酮对精神分裂症患者生活质量的影响   总被引:5,自引:2,他引:3  
目的:比较利培酮与氟哌啶醇对精神分裂症患者生活质量的影响。方法:对门诊72例服用氟哌啶醇及74例服用利培酮的精神分裂症患者用生活质量综合评定问卷(GQOLI)、阳性与阴性症状量表(PANSS)、副反应量表(TESS)进行评定。结果:利培酮组患者治疗后生活质量有所提高,而氟哌啶醇组患者生活质量有所下降。结论:利培酮治疗有利于患者提高生活质量。  相似文献
